Cisco Leads the Industry in Power over Ethernet

Cisco was the first to innovate in-line power and continues the evolution of technology standards by delivering IEEE 802.3af-compliant Power over Ethernet solutions for the Cisco Catalyst portfolio of intelligent switching devices. Cisco delivers 802.3af-compliant Power over Ethernet for the Cisco Catalyst 6500 and 4500 series, and introduces the Cisco Catalyst 3560 and Catalyst 3750 stackable fixed-configuration Power over Ethernet switches. Cisco has shipped more than 18 million in-line Power over Ethernet capable ports on the Cisco Catalyst 6500, 4500, 4000 and 3500 Series switches. Cisco standards-based Power over Ethernet switches allow you to expand your network to support new Ethernet-powered devices such as IP video surveillance, magnetic card readers for building management, and retail video kiosks. Investment Protection

Cisco delivers superior investment protection by "engineering in" backward and forward compatibility whenever possible, enabling you to gain the highest possible return on your infrastructure investments. The Cisco Catalyst 6500 and 4500 series switches were designed with support for Power over Ethernet. Each chassis supports standards-based Power over Ethernet line cards, giving you a longer deployment life from your initial infrastructure investment. The Cisco Catalyst 6500 Series provides an incremental benefit by offering field-upgradable 10/100 and Gigabit Ethernet line cards that allow users to add Power over Ethernet capabilities when needed, reducing initial capital expenditures and allowing for a "pay-as-you-grow" approach.

The new 802.3af Power over Ethernet line cards for the Cisco Catalyst 6500 and 4500 chassis-based switches and the Cisco Catalyst 3750 stackable and 3560 fixed-configuration switches will support both Cisco pre-standard in-line power and 802.3af Power over Ethernet delivery. The newly announced Cisco IP Phone 7970G also supports both Cisco in-line power and the 802.3af standard. Cisco will continue to develop powered end devices, such as IP phones and wireless access points that will support both the original Cisco implementation and the 802.3af standard as well to provide investment protection to customers with pre-standard in-line power devices and line cards. This helps ensure compatibility with your current installed products, as well as future devices.

Intelligent Power Management

Cisco Catalyst intelligent switches not only support a complete implementation of the IEEE optional power classification features, but further extend these capabilities with Intelligent Power Management (IPM). IPM enables scalable, intelligent management of power delivery for all Power over Ethernet ports in the switch. IPM enables the granular control of power delivery to each Power over Ethernet port, allowing for power reservation, power allocation, power oversubscription management, and power prioritization. This extends the manageability of Power over Ethernet deployments by minimizing wall power requirements, and maximizing power usage on a per-port basis, and better managing monthly electrical power costs.
